Output 3a50266643159bcc7b832609fc45d77f7a3dc9e50098e3cb11b740294c6b3122:0

value
8319700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22de166f866382de9862fa95ca937ea0f01f9a6f OP_EQUAL
address
34sNwz86WMoyDy2DU2NDb2NpPmQdWVQafU
transaction
3a50266643159bcc7b832609fc45d77f7a3dc9e50098e3cb11b740294c6b3122
spent
true